Why Sustainability Matters

The beverage industry is facing increasing pressure to adopt sustainable practices. Consumers are becoming more aware of environmental issues, prompting manufacturers to rethink their production processes and materials used.

Eco-Friendly Manufacturing Practices

Many manufacturers are now utilizing organic ingredients and adopting processes that reduce their carbon footprint. From eco-friendly packaging to ethical sourcing, these practices are becoming essential for companies aiming to maintain a competitive edge.

Exporting Sustainable Products

When exporting beverages, sustainability can also enhance a brand's reputation in international markets. Retailers and consumers alike are keen to support brands that align with their values, making this a strategic advantage for exporters.

Challenges and Solutions

Transitioning to sustainable practices can be challenging for manufacturers, particularly in adapting existing supply chains. However, investment in new technologies and partnerships with eco-conscious suppliers can ease this transition.
